4 Ways to Expand Your Home Storage

No matter who you are and how big your home is, most of us struggle from time to time with knowing the best places to store things. If your home is on the smaller side you might feel like you are bursting at the seams, but a few clever solutions can transform your storage experience and make your home much more manageable. Here are four ways to expand your home storage. Home Storage

Look up for empty space

Most of us would look at a floor plan when deciding where to put our next lot of shelving, but there is actually a whole load of unused space in most of our homes, on the top third of the wall. This is a great place for floating shelves, but my all time favourite way to use this space is to create a cat playground, where they can sleep and play and keep their minds stimulated, all the while freeing up floor space because there is no more need for cat trees or scratching posts on the ground.

Make the most of your outdoor space

Not everybody is lucky enough to have an outdoor space, but if you have got anything to work with then this is a great chance to extend your storage. Not only is a garden great because you can add structures that will hold things for you, like sheds and workshops with plenty of shelving, but garage storage is a great way to ensure that your belongings are in a safe and – most importantly – watertight place, for your own peace of mind. You might not realise just how much space you have in your garage, especially if you have a large car or lots of bikes, but actually if you use clever shelving to line the walls you would be surprised by how much you can store.

Use furniture with built in storage solutions

It might seem difficult to work out a way to have all of the furniture that you need AND find ways to build storage in around that, but you could try combining the two and using furniture in your home that offers you a built-in storage solution. For example a Divan bed is a great way to give yourself more space to hide things away underneath, and you could even get an Ottoman style couch that opens up to provide you that same level of space.

Ensure that your loft works for you

Many homes have a loft space that comes as standard, but because of building degradation and the space not being looked after, many people find that their loft is not usable for the amount of storage that they require. Make your loft work for you by spending time on the flooring, ensuring it is a safe place to support the weight of all of your storage (as well as you, when you stand in there to put things away!) and install racking along the walls to make the most of the space that is available to you.   Is finding storage a constant problem in your life, or are you somebody who prefers things to stay a little bit more minimalistic?
